My husband and I were state delegates at Colorado’s convention on Saturday and we voted for a slate of Cruz delegates. 

Back in August the party leadership saw that there were many contenders for the office of President. They did not want our state to be stuck with a candidate who would not be on the ballot. They had the foresight to see that this would go to a contested ballot. They wanted Colorado to make a decisive difference in the national election. They didn’t want our votes to be wasted, like last time we voted for Rick Santorum and the delegates were stuck.

This had nothing to do with Trump. He wasn’t the front runner then!

Ted Cruz: No, Rule 40 shouldn’t be changed to make John Kasich eligible for the nomination

40B is the rule that states that a candidate must have a majority of delegates from 8 states in order to even be nominated on the Convention floor. This was changed from simply winning a plurality of delegates in 5 states in 2012 after it was discovered that the IA delegation had been taken over by Paul supporters even though Santorum and Romney virtually tied for first place in IA. (Santorum eventually won with mere dozens of votes to spare two weeks after caucus night.)

There is no way at this point that Kasich can meet either the 2008 or 2012 standard to even be nominated at the Convention. You gotta wonder what the heck is he doing by continuing in the race. At this point he is merely blocking downfield for Trump. A vote for Kasich is a vote for Trump.

This edition of Rich TAkes! leads off with a few stories about the San Bernadino shooter’s iPhone 5c.

Has Obama recognized that this couple were radical jihadis yet? Anyway, the FBI apparently tried to change the phone or the iCloud password, and got themselves completely locked out of the phone, so that is why they got a court order to force Apple to create software which completely bypasses the built in encryption and security in iOS. Apple will be appealing, and the outcome will have grave consequences for us all if the government prevails.
